On Wed, 20 Aug 2003, Stephan Szabo wrote:

>
> On Wed, 20 Aug 2003, Mike Winter wrote:
>
> > I'm sure many on this list are sick of hearing about this problem, but it
> > was on the fix list for 7.4, but doesn't appear to have been changed.
>
> IN (subselect) was changed for 7.4 (although I'm not sure of the list
> mentions the difference). I don't know of any major changes to IN
> (valuelist) though.

Thanks, Stephan. I was really hoping that the IN(valuelist) was going to
be changed at the same time, because it really is unusable for anything
over a couple of thousand values.
